Repetition rate in Grade 6 of primary education, female in Trinidad and Tobago
Trinidad and Tobago: Repetition rate in Grade 6 of primary education, female was 7.2% in 2022. ▲ Rising
Repetition rate in Grade 6 of primary education, female in Trinidad and Tobago, 1987–2022
Source: UNESCO Institute for Statistics. Measured in %.
Analysis
Trinidad and Tobago recorded 7.2% for repetition rate in grade 6 of primary education, female in 2022. That is the highest value across all 8 years on record.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 150.7% on the previous year and up 19.2% over ten years.
Over the whole period, repetition rate in grade 6 of primary education, female in Trinidad and Tobago peaked at 7.2% in 2022 and was at its lowest, 0.6%, in 1987.
Trinidad and Tobago ranks 26th of 137 countries on this measure, in the top quarter.
Repetition rate in Grade 6 of primary education, female in Trinidad and Tobago, year by year
| Year | % |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 1987 | 0.6% | — |
| 2004 | 4.0% | +590.7% |
| 2007 | 5.4% | +35.8% |
| 2008 | 4.5% | -16.2% |
| 2009 | 6.1% | +34.8% |
| 2019 | 6.0% | -0.5% |
| 2020 | 2.9% | -52.2% |
| 2022 | 7.2% | +150.7% |
Trinidad and Tobago compared with similar countries
- Trinidad and Tobago's 7.2% is above the median for high income countries, which is 0.4%, 19.0× the median. (47 countries reporting)
- Trinidad and Tobago's 7.2% is above the median for Latin America & Caribbean, which is 0.8%, 8.8× the median. (32 countries reporting)
